Financial Report
Sandra Kuchta presented the financial report.
Revenues for the month of June 2016 were $144,862.82 compared to budgeted
revenues of $148,901.10, $4,038.28 under budgeted revenues and $1,202.58
under June 2015 revenues.
Year to date revenues through June 2016 were $662,984.57 compared to
budgeted revenues of $650,942.12, $12,042.45 over budgeted revenues and
$26,089.25 over year to date June 2015 revenue.
Expenses for the month of June 2016 were $123,434.51, compared to budgeted
expenses of $129,469.67, $6,035.16 under budgeted expenses and $407.63 under
June 2015 expenses.
Year to date expenses for June 2016 were $556,444.17 compared to budgeted
expenses of $551,922.80, $4,521.37 over budgeted expenses and $19,259.86 over
year to date June 2015 expenses.
Revenues in excess of expenses in the month of June 2016 were $21,428.31.
Revenues in excess of expenses year to date through the end of June 2016 by
$106,540.40, compared to a budgeted figure of $99,019.32, $7,521.08 over the
budgeted figure.
The cash balance at the end of June 2016 was $161,675.74.
A motion to accept the financial report was made by Mr. Podurgiel, seconded by
Mr. DiBattista, and approved unanimously.

• Superintendent’s Report
Mr. Morse reported on gypsy moth activity. This continues to be a risk to the
course. It appears there will be at least two generations of gypsy moth this year.
Thus far the course has escaped significant damage. Maintenance is being
particularly watchful of the oaks at the course and have sprayed and pulled egg
masses off a number of oak trees. There are too many oaks at the course to
effectively treat all of them.
Mr. Morse reported on lighting problems at the maintenance building in the
yard, the problem is becoming apparent due to the early arrival of staff. He
recommended that several of the existing lights be replaced with LED’s and he
has an estimate on the cost of the work of $1,200. A motion was made by Mr.
Battista to approve the expenditure of up to $1,300 to replace lighting as
necessary in the maintenance department lot. This motion was seconded by Mr.
Mereen and approved unanimously.

OLD BUSINESS
Mr. Mereen reported on the meetings and review which continues with respect to
irrigation issues at the golf course. Recently there was another meeting with
engineers and discussions about test wells and measuring both the volume of
water produced at the wells and any consequential effect on surface water or
subsurface water at the course. He pointed out that the Authority would need to
consider any reduction in the surface or subsurface water as a result of drawing
water from wells as something would make it more difficult to get the necessary
permits. He also indicated that we should soon file appropriate applications with
the DEEP to allow the DEEP to do an early review of the project including studies
on the National Diversity Database. He would like to present an overview of the
project to the city council at an early meeting and will seek to have a resolution
introduced at the council to permit the city manager to sign off on applications in
support of this project.
